Lionel Rogg

from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Lionel Rogg (born April 21, 1936 in Geneva ) is a Swiss organist , composer and university professor .

Education and biography

Rogg studied organ playing with Pierre Segond and piano with Nikita Magaloff at the Conservatoire de musique de Genève . He has given concerts around the world in particular with the works of Johann Sebastian Bach , whose entire organ works he recorded three times on phonograms. Rogg played a. a. also the complete organ works by Dietrich Buxtehude on record. He taught at the Geneva Conservatory until 2001 and is professor of artistic organ and improvisation at the Royal Academy of Music in London . In 1989 he was awarded a doctorate honoris causa by the University of Geneva .

Organ works

  • Partita sopra "Now rejoice" (1976)
  • Variations on le Psaume 91 (1983)
  • Introduction, Ricercare, Toccata (1985)
  • Elégie (1985)
  • Contrepointes pour les pédales (1986)
  • Deux Etudes (1986): Le Canon improbable; Tètracordes;
  • Monodies (1986)
  • Six Versets sur le Psaume 92 (1986-87)
  • Tons sur Tons (1988)
  • Toccata ritmica (1988-89)
  • Homage to Messiaen (1990)
  • Arcature (Apparition, Evocation, Finale) (1994)
  • La Femme et le Dragon (1995)
  • Livre d'orgue (1996) (Suite pour l'orgue français)
  • Lux aeterna (1996)
  • Homage à Takemitsu (Les Quatre Eléments) (1997)
  • Toccata capricciosa (1999)
  • Homage to Maurice Duruflé (1999)
  • Méditation sur BACH (2000)
  • Chaconne (2001)
  • fandango
  • Kaléidoscope
  • Variations on "Ah! Vous dirai-je, Maman"

Works for organ and other instruments

  • Elégie pour violon et orgue (1985)
  • Recitativo pour synthés et orgue (1988)
  • Pièce pour Hautbois et Orgue (1991)
  • "Incantations", orgue et percussion (1993)
  • "Laudes creaturarum" pour soprano et orgue (2001)
  • "Laudes organi" pour soprano solo, choeur et orgue (2000)
  • Two songs of Mary pour soprano et orgue (1956)

Works for organ and orchestra

  • Concerto pour orgue et orchester (1991) (world premiere on February 14, 1993 in Geneva)
  • Concertino pour orgue et orchester de chamber (1965)
